Position Overview
Optics & Allied Engg. Pvt. Ltd. is seeking a proactive and detail-oriented PPC Engineer to manage production planning, scheduling, material coordination, and order execution for precision optical and engineering components. The role requires close coordination with Production, Purchase, Stores, Quality, and Dispatch to ensure timely delivery while maintaining optimum inventory levels and production efficiency.
Key ResponsibilitiesProduction Planning
- Prepare daily, weekly, and monthly production plans based on customer orders and delivery schedules.
- Develop production schedules considering machine capacity, manpower availability, and material readiness.
- Ensure timely release of Work Orders (WO) to production.
Production Control
- Monitor daily production against the plan and identify delays or bottlenecks.
- Follow up with production departments to ensure adherence to schedules.
- Coordinate with all departments to achieve on-time delivery targets.
